We offer behavioral (non-medication) treatments for a variety of sleep problems. This sleep therapy treatment is known to be just as effective and longer-lasting than sleeping pills. In fact, both the American College of Physicians and American Academy of Sleep Medicine recommend behavioral interventions as the first line of treatment for adults with insomnia.
